The Edmonton Oilers are facing a significant challenge in their Western Conference semifinal series against the Vegas Golden Knights, as goalie Calvin Pickard is expected to miss the remainder of the series due to injury. Pickard, who has been instrumental in the Oilers’ postseason run, suffered an injury during the team’s 5-4 overtime win over the Golden Knights on May 8.

 

According to a report by TSN, Pickard has not practiced since the injury and is likely to miss the rest of the series. The injury occurred when Golden Knights forward Tomas Hertl fell into Pickard’s left leg, and although the goalie finished the game, it appears that the damage was more severe than initially thought.

Pickard has been a revelation for the Oilers in the postseason, winning all six starts in the net. After Stuart Skinner struggled in the first two games of the first round against the Los Angeles Kings, Oilers head coach Kris Knoblauch turned to Pickard, who responded with four consecutive wins to help the team advance. Pickard then continued his strong play in the second round, earning victories in the first two games against the Golden Knights.

 

With Pickard out, the Oilers will likely turn to Stuart Skinner to start in net. Skinner has been inconsistent this postseason, but he has shown flashes of brilliance. However, the Oilers will need him to perform at a high level if they want to win the series.
